Brick veneer replacement services involve removing damaged or deteriorating brick veneer and installing new brick siding to restore the appearance and structural integrity of a building’s exterior. This process typically includes carefully taking down the existing veneer, inspecting the underlying wall for any issues, and then applying new brick to match the original style. Skilled contractors ensure that the replacement work blends seamlessly with the existing structure, providing a durable and attractive finish that enhances the property's overall look.

This service helps address common problems such as cracked, crumbling, or loose bricks, which can compromise the safety and insulation of a building. Water infiltration through damaged veneer can lead to further issues like mold, wood rot, or interior damage. Brick veneer replacement is also a practical solution for properties affected by aging or weather-related wear, preventing minor issues from developing into more costly repairs. By replacing compromised brickwork, homeowners can maintain the value and longevity of their property’s exterior.

The overview below groups typical Brick Veneer Replacement proj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- typically cost between $250 and $600 for many routine brick veneer repairs, such as replacing broken bricks or fixing minor cracks. Most projects in this range are straightforward and involve minimal labor. Larger or more complex repairs can exceed this range but are less common.

Partial Replacement - replacing sections of brick veneer usually falls between $1,000 and $3,000, depending on the size and complexity of the area. Many local contractors handle these projects within this band, with costs increasing for larger or more intricate work.

Full Replacement - a complete brick veneer replacement can range from $8,000 to $15,000 or more, especially for larger homes or extensive work. These projects are less frequent and tend to involve significant labor and material costs.

Major Renovations - extensive brick veneer overhauls or structural replacements can reach $20,000 or higher. Such projects are relatively rare and typically involve complex planning and specialized craftsmanship, leading to higher costs.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are the signs that brick veneer needs to be replaced? Indicators include cracked, bulging, or crumbling bricks, mortar deterioration, or water infiltration issues that cannot be repaired effectively.

Can brick veneer be replaced without damaging the existing structure? Yes, experienced contractors can carefully remove and replace damaged brick veneer while preserving the integrity of the underlying structure.

What types of materials are used for brick veneer replacement? Local service providers typically use matching bricks and mortar to ensure consistency, but options may include different styles or finishes based on the project.

Is brick veneer replacement necessary for structural stability? While brick veneer primarily serves aesthetic purposes, replacement can be important if deterioration affects the building’s overall stability or safety.
